Cake Base
- 1 ½ cups 180 g all-purpose flour
- 1 cup 200 g granulated sugar
- ½ cup 50 g cocoa powder
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 cup 120 ml milk, lukewarm
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- ¼ cup 60 ml vegetable oil
Three Milks Mixture
- 1 cup 240 ml sweetened condensed milk
- 1 cup 240 ml evaporated milk
- 1 cup 240 ml he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ons cocoa powder optional, for extra chocolate flavor
Topping
- 1 cup 240 ml heavy cream, chilled
- 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
- Chocolate shavings or cocoa powder for garnish
- Optional: fresh strawberries for serving
Prepare the Cake Base
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
In a large b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t.
In another bowl, mix milk, eggs, vanilla, and oil.
Combine wet and dry ingredients until smooth. Pour into the prepared dish.
Bake 25–30 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Let cool completely.
Make the Three Milks Mixture
In a bowl, combine sweetened condensed milk, evaporated milk, heavy cream, and cocoa powder. Mix well.
Soak the Cake
Poke holes all over the cooled cake with a skewer or fork.
Pour the milk mixture slowly over the cake, ensuring even absorption.
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or overnight for best results.
Garnish and Serve
Top with chocolate shavings or cocoa powder.
Optionally, add fresh strawberries for color and flavor.
Serve chilled.
✅ Tips for Perfect Chocolate Tres Leches Cake
-
Use high-quality cocoa or melted chocolate to enhance the chocolate flavor.
-
Avoid overbaking to keep the sponge light and moist.
-
Let the cake cool completely before pouring the milk mixture to prevent sogginess.
-
For a twist, add almond milk, soy milk, or a teaspoon of coffee to the milk mixture.
✅ Storage
-
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
-
Let sit at room temperature for 30 minutes before serving for best texture and flavor.
✅ Variations
-
Strawberry Chocolate Tres Leches: Layer fresh strawberry slices or drizzle strawberry syrup on top.
-
Nutty Chocolate Tres Leches: Add chopped nuts or almond slices for texture.
-
Mocha Twist: Add 1 teaspoon instant coffee to the milk mixture for a mocha flavor.
